Is Julio Cabrera Miami's best bartender?
After winning a local Campari Best Aperitivo Cocktail Competition, Sra. Martinez's master mixologist takes a national title
6/5/2012
Sra. Martinez's Julio Cabrera, who back in April won a spot at the Manhattan Cocktail Classic via a United States Bartenders' Guild Campari cocktail competition, was the big winner at The USBG Mixing Star bartending competition sponsored by DISARONNO last night in Las Vegas at The Palazzo’s Azure Pool. The competition was the culmination of a nationwide bartending competition seeking a bartender with “stage presence” and “star quality”. Cabrera not only takes the title of USBG's Mixing Star, but wins a trip to Mumbai, India for a chance to appear in a Bollywood film. His winning cocktail? The Pearfecta Vita. Recipe below:
Pearfecta Vita
1 oz. DISARONNO
1 oz. Remy Martin VSOP
.75 oz.Pear Nectar
.25 oz.Herbes de Provence Honey Syrup
.5 oz.Lemon Juice
Shake and serve up in a martini glass. Rim the glass with herbes de provence powder sugar and garnish with two slices of fresh pear.
